How to Write an RFP for LMS Vendors

Web Courseworks

An RFP, or Request for Proposal, allows you to outline what you are looking for in your ideal Learning Management System vendor and creates a standardized form or checklist for all would-be vendors to follow. Some buyers will actually use the RFP sections to “score” vendor written responses or demo presentations. Executive Summary.

How to Write a Winning RFP to Hire the Best E-learning Vendor

CommLab India

Before you begin formulating the e-learning vendor selection criteria for your organization, work on the all-important step of writing a request for proposal (RFP). An RFP helps you list your requirements clearly so that you elicit responses from the right e-learning solution providers who match your needs, expectations, and budget.
